The 2-Adjunction that relates Universal Arrows and Extensive Monads
Abstract
In this article the 2-adjunction that relates universal arrows and extensive monads is constructed explicitly. This 2-adjunction resembles the one that relates adjunctions and monads since the 2-category of universal arrows is isomorphic to the 2-category of adjunctions and the 2-category of extensive monads is isomorphic to the 2-category of monads. This article would be useful as a foundation for a theory relating pseudo adjunctions and pseudo monads for Gray-categories. On the other hand, it might function as an accesible tool for computer scientists on extensive monads.
